tracheobronchial tuberculosis (Q55009294)

A pulmonary tuberculosis involving inflammation of trachea and bronchi. The symptoms include dry cough followed by dyspnea, localized wheezing, hemoptysis, hoarseness, anorexia, weight loss, chest pain and fever.
